The Brain's Own Cleaning Cycle
Here is something that was only confirmed in the last fifteen years or so: your brain physically shrinks, very slightly, while you sleep. Not dangerously – just enough to widen the gaps between cells and let cerebrospinal fluid rush through in pulses, flushing out the metabolic waste that has built up during the day. One of the things it is clearing is beta-amyloid, the protein that accumulates in Alzheimer's disease. Your brain, in other words, runs its own rubbish collection service. It can only do it when you are asleep. Miss the shift too often and the bins don't get emptied.
The system is called the glymphatic system – the "g" is for glial cells, the support cells that orchestrate the whole thing. Discovered in mice in 2012 and confirmed in humans shortly after, it spent the entire history of medicine being completely unknown to medicine.
What Growth Hormone Is Actually For
The pituitary gland releases most of its daily growth hormone in one big pulse, timed to the first deep sleep cycle of the night, usually sometime in the first couple of hours. Children need it to grow, obviously. Adults need it too – just for different things: repair of muscle tissue, maintenance of bone density, regulation of fat metabolism. It is not a performance drug. Maintenance. Like the boiler running its diagnostics at midnight.
The liver, meanwhile, has its own overnight agenda. Its detoxification cycles – the ones that process everything from alcohol to medications to the normal byproducts of digestion – run hardest in the small hours. Traditional Chinese medicine mapped the liver's "peak time" to between 1am and 3am, which is a somewhat different framework from biochemistry, but they were not entirely wrong about when the organ is busiest.
The Immune System's Night Meeting
Your immune system does not stop during the day, but it does reorganise at night. Certain immune cells – T-cells among them – consolidate the day's learning, reinforcing responses to anything the body encountered. This is partly why sleep deprivation makes you more susceptible to illness, and why you tend to feel worse at night when you are already sick: the immune system is running hotter then, doing its most active work.
It is also when the skin does its serious repair. Cell turnover peaks in the early hours, and collagen synthesis – the process that keeps skin structured and elastic – increases during sleep. Not marketing copy from a moisturiser brand. Just biology. What Happens When the Shift Gets Cut Short
The cruel thing about sleep debt is that you cannot fully pay it back. A run of short nights does not just leave you tired. It means the glymphatic flush was incomplete, the growth hormone pulse was interrupted, the immune reorganisation was truncated. A long lie-in at the weekend recovers some of it, but the specific timed processes – the ones triggered by circadian rhythm rather than just tiredness – cannot always be rescheduled at will.
The body is not passive at night. It is running on a programme older than consciousness itself, doing the jobs that daylight and wakefulness simply crowd out. You contribute to it mainly by leaving it alone.
